The Definitive Guide to free online games
We get provisions from the game companies reviewed on this page which can impact the rating. We do not Review all games in the marketplace. oneOkay, it may not be Titanfall 3, but Apex Legends can be a deserving alternative. Set in precisely the same planet as Respawn's mech-based shooter, the Apex Games Mix basic battle royale with the character-d